PL/SQL: isNumeric ?

pl/sql

Existe uma maneira simples de verificar em PL/SQL,  se o conteúdo de uma variável é numérica ou não: LENGTH(TRIM(TRANSLATE(<string>, ‘.+-0123456789’, ‘ ‘))) Exemplos: LENGTH(TRIM(TRANSLATE(‘943’, ‘.+-0123456789’, ‘ ‘))) retorna NULL = NUMERICO LENGTH(TRIM(TRANSLATE(‘-13’, ‘.+-0123456789’, ‘ ‘))) retorna NULL = NUMERICO LENGTH(TRIM(TRANSLATE(‘teste1’, ‘.+-0123456789’, ‘ ‘))) retorna 5 = ALFANUMÉRICO LENGTH(TRIM(TRANSLATE(‘t1’, ‘.+-0123456789’, ‘ ‘))) retorna 1 = ALFANUMÉRICO … Ler mais

Ads Blocker Image Powered by Code Help Pro

Ads Blocker Detectado !

Verificamos que está usando alguma extensão para bloquear os anúncios. O GPO (Grupo de Profissionais Oracle) obtém a sua renda através dos anúncios, para assim manter toda a estrutura dedicada a universalização do conhecimento.

Se você gosta de nosso trabalho, pedimos por gentileza que desabilite o ads blocker. Trabalhamos somente com o Google Adsense e tentamos ao máximo exibir apenas o necessário.

Agradecemos de antemão ! :)

Powered By
Best Wordpress Adblock Detecting Plugin | CHP Adblock